Modern theories of acting follow stanislavsky and emphasize emotional truthfulness achieved through selfexpression, but an older tradition emphasizes technique and imitation and this emphasis is argued to be equally relevant to movie acting. Mysterien eines frisiersalons is a comic, slapstick german film of 33 minutes, created by bertolt brecht, directed by erich engel, and starring the munich cabaret clown karl valentin and leading stage actor erwin faber. An important principle of realist acting, borrowed from the theater, is to devise situations in which characters talk about one thing while doing something else.
